Steps are counted during swim activity on vivoactive 3

I've recently noticed that when swimming in the pool my garmin vivoactive 3 is counting steps even though it is tracking my swim activity that I've started.

Did not notice it before so it might be current firmware glitch (ver. 7.2)

Can this issue be fixed? 

  • It is not a bug, it is a feature.

    Read more for example here: https://support.garmin.com/en-US/?faq=z1TfJCqajl8ZEZey72gg98

    Wear the watch under the swim cap, or on the neck (e.g. with a longer strap), if you mind the extra steps
